Dissociating serialized drug units from lots
To remove serialized drug units from the lot, you dissociate the drug units. You can assign the serialized drug units to a lot by associating serialized drugs.
- Click Supplies (
).
- On the left, in the Set-Up section, select Lots & Expiry.
This list shows the total number of drug supplies associated with a lot. For descriptions of the fields on this page, see Lot Association.
You can disassociate supply units from this view, or you can click a Lot identifier to see the Type List view for more detailed information about the drug units (examples: description, expiration date, sequence numbers, quantity available).
You can dissociate drug units from either view.
- From either the Lot List or the Type List view, click Dissociate next to the lot.
A list of drug units that are associated with the lot appears.
- (optional but recommended for long lists) Type the Sequence Range in the Start and End textboxes, and click Apply.
- To select the drug units:
- To select specific drug units from the view, select or deselect the Select checkbox for the units until the only the drug units you want to dissociate have check marks next to them.
Then click Dissociate Selected.
or
- To associate all drug units on the page, click Dissociate All.
